OLEASTRUM

OLEASTRUM (Ὀλέαστρον, Ptol. 2.4.14).


1.

A town in Hispania Baetica, in the jurisdiction of Gades, with a grove of the same name near it. (Mela, 3.1.4; Plin. Nat. 3.1. s. 3.)


2.

A town of the Cosetani in Hispania Tarraconensis, on the road from Dertosa to Tarraco (Itin. Ant. 399). Probably the same town mentioned by Strabo (iii. p.159), but erroneously placed by him near Saguntum. It seems also to have given name to the lead mentioned by Pliny (34.17. s. 49). Variously identified with Balaguer, Miramar, and S. Lucar de Barrameda (Marca, Hisp. 2.11. p. 142.) [T.H.D]
